Who should pick which
- Student reviewing lecture slides and academic papers offlinePick: OneDocs
OneDocs is free, runs locally, and extracts key points, timelines, and formulas from PDFs using 40+ AI models, ideal for offline study.
- AI safety researcher red-teaming a new modelPick: Surge AI
Surge's expert workforce (doctors, lawyers, engineers) provides rigorous adversary testing, and its benchmarks like Antidote and Riemann-bench expose model weaknesses that automated tools miss.
- Privacy-conscious professional analyzing sensitive reportsPick: OneDocs
OneDocs parses files locally with zero upload, ensuring document content never leaves the device—critical for confidential data.
- Frontier AI lab training LLMs with RLHFPick: Surge AI
Surge offers domain experts for high-quality preference data, and its ComplexConstraints benchmark helped a 4B model reach parity with 60x larger model, as per recent news.
- Researcher synthesizing multiple PDF reportsPick: OneDocs
OneDocs' multi-document merge analysis and batch processing enable quick synthesis across PDFs, supporting up to 40 models for varied viewpoints.
